You have a deck of 52 cards. What’s the probability you draw exactly 1 heart in 2 draws with replacement?

Answer: The probability you draw exactly 1 heart in 2 draws with replacement is 3/16

Explanation:

The probability of picking a heart in a pack of 52 playing card is

13/52=1/4

The probability of drawing exactly one heart in 2 draws with replacement mean;

That the first draw is a heart and the second draw is not a heart

The probability that the second draw is not a heart is= 1-1/4= 3/4

Therefore

The probability you draw exactly 1 heart in 2 draws with replacement is

1/4 * 3/4 = 3/16

Answer: The required probability is
(3)/(16).

Step-by-step explanation: Given a deck of 52 cards.

We are to find the probability of drawing exactly 1 heart in 2 draws with replacement.

Number of hearts in the deck = 13.

Let S be the sample space of drawing two cards from the deck of 52 cards and E denote the event of drawing exactly 1 heart in 2 draws with replacement.

Then,


n(S)=^(52)C_1*^(52)C_1=52*52,\\\\\\n(E)=^(13)C_1*^(52-13)C_1=13*39.

Therefore, the probability of event E is


P(E)=(n(E))/(n(S))=(13*39)/(52*52)=(1*3)/(4*4)=(3)/(16).

Thus, the required probability is
(3)/(16).
